Safipur is a small town located in the northern Indian state of Uttar Pradesh. It falls under the jurisdiction of the Unnao district and is situated at a distance of approximately 70 kilometers from the state capital, Lucknow. This bustling town is known for its rich cultural heritage, historical significance, and its contribution to the agricultural industry. With a population of around 20,000 people, Safipur offers a tranquil escape from the bustling city life while still providing the amenities of modern urban living.

Additionally, Safipur is primarily an agricultural town, with a significant portion of the population engaged in farming. The fertile soil, coupled with an efficient irrigation system, has made agriculture the backbone of the town's economy. Various crops such as wheat, rice, sugarcane, and vegetables are cultivated, contributing significantly to the state's agricultural output.
